Rayford Crossing RV Resort in Spring, TX, offers 276 full-hookup RV sites and 4 cottages, with 20, 30, and 50-amp service and room for rigs up to 80 feet. Sites are tiered clearly across six categories — standard, premium, and elite, each in back-in and pull-thru — all carrying water, sewer, electric, and cable TV with site-delivered WiFi, a fire pit, picnic table, and barbecue. The resort is rated big rig friendly, and at 80 feet the elite pull-thrus take the longest coaches without unhitching. Open all year. Laundry, a bathhouse with showers, a general store, and on-site dining cover the practical side. Pets are welcome, with a dog park. An outdoor pool, a fitness center, a game room with an arcade and billiards, a library, a pavilion, ping pong, shuffleboard, horseshoes, a pond for fishing, and walking trails fill the grounds. Spring sits between downtown Houston and Conroe in the fast-growing north Houston corridor, which makes the resort equally practical for long-term residents, commuting professionals, and travelers moving along I-45.
